Job Title: Manager, Supply Chain Information Systems
Location: Boston, MA preferred (open to remote candidates)
Contract Duration: 6+ months
FLSA Status: Exempt

Overview

We are seeking a Manager, Supply Chain Information Systems to lead the operation, maintenance, and strategic direction of materials management and supply chain systems within a large healthcare environment. This role is responsible for driving system optimization, supporting operational efficiency, and enabling cost-saving initiatives across the supply chain function.

Key Responsibilities
  • Oversee the administration, maintenance, and enhancement of Materials Management Information Systems (MMIS) and related platforms
  • Develop and implement system protocols, including vendor and item maintenance, user setup, troubleshooting, and new functionality
  • Partner with internal stakeholders and IT teams to manage system upgrades, patches, and performance
  • Lead system-related projects, including implementations, reporting enhancements, and process improvements
  • Direct and mentor staff responsible for system operations, reporting, and data management
  • Monitor vendor performance, contract compliance, and pricing accuracy using system tools
  • Identify and recommend cost-saving opportunities and operational efficiencies
  • Serve as the primary liaison between Supply Chain and Accounts Payable for system and invoice discrepancies
  • Develop and maintain policies, procedures, and training documentation
  • Provide training and support to internal teams on system usage and best practices
